#7e3f08 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#7e3f08 is composed of 49.4% red, 24.7% green and 3.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 50% magenta, 93.7% yellow and 50.6% black. It has a hue angle of 28 degrees, a saturation of 88.1% and a lightness of 26.3%. #7e3f08 color hex could be obtained by blending #fc7e10 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#663300.

Shades and Tints of #7e3f08

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0f0801 is the darkest color, while #fffdfc is the lightest one.

Tones of #7e3f08

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#454341 is the less saturated color, while #833f03 is the most saturated one.
